From 387705e0a98c62f44583e86596ff8acc56145b41 Mon Sep 17 00:00:00 2001 From: iga Date: Tue, 1 Apr 2014 20:46:10 +0900 Subject: [PATCH] save --- jcfa/src/jp/igapyon/jcfa/JavaClassFileAnalyzer.java | 3 +++ jcfa/testJavaClass/output/test/TestJavaClass001.jcfa | 2 +- jcfa/testJavaClass/output/test/TestJavaClass002.jcfa | 11 +++++++---- jcfa/testJavaClass/output/test/TestJavaClass003.jcfa | 16 ++++++++-------- 4 files changed, 19 insertions(+), 13 deletions(-) diff --git a/jcfa/src/jp/igapyon/jcfa/JavaClassFileAnalyzer.java b/jcfa/src/jp/igapyon/jcfa/JavaClassFileAnalyzer.java index 1e2e369..6686a23 100644 --- a/jcfa/src/jp/igapyon/jcfa/JavaClassFileAnalyzer.java +++ b/jcfa/src/jp/igapyon/jcfa/JavaClassFileAnalyzer.java @@ -56,6 +56,7 @@ public class JavaClassFileAnalyzer { jcfaClass.getComment().getCommentList() .add("TODO import func. is missing."); + jcfaClass.getComment().setJavaDoc(true); final String[] split = jc.getClassName().split("\\."); File actualyTargetDir = outputDir; @@ -94,6 +95,8 @@ public class JavaClassFileAnalyzer { jcfaField.setName(field.getName()); jcfaClass.getFieldList().add(jcfaField); + jcfaField.getComment().setJavaDoc(true); + // TODO type should be more collect. jcfaField.setType(field.getType().toString()); diff --git a/jcfa/testJavaClass/output/test/TestJavaClass001.jcfa b/jcfa/testJavaClass/output/test/TestJavaClass001.jcfa index 1420427..1d1b3af 100644 --- a/jcfa/testJavaClass/output/test/TestJavaClass001.jcfa +++ b/jcfa/testJavaClass/output/test/TestJavaClass001.jcfa @@ -1,6 +1,6 @@ package test; -/* TODO import func. is missing. */ +/** TODO import func. is missing. */ public class TestJavaClass001 { /** Default constructor. */ public TestJavaClass001() { diff --git a/jcfa/testJavaClass/output/test/TestJavaClass002.jcfa b/jcfa/testJavaClass/output/test/TestJavaClass002.jcfa index 9af8b04..b8ffb76 100644 --- a/jcfa/testJavaClass/output/test/TestJavaClass002.jcfa +++ b/jcfa/testJavaClass/output/test/TestJavaClass002.jcfa @@ -1,12 +1,15 @@ package test; -/* TODO import func. is missing. */ +/** TODO import func. is missing. */ public class TestJavaClass002 { - /* FIXME other type support is missing.
Now only String. */ + /** + * FIXME other type support is missing.
+ * Now only String. + */ public static final java.lang.String TEST_001 = "Hello jcfa world."; - /* */ + /** */ protected static java.lang.String test002; - /* */ + /** */ private int test003; /** Default constructor. */ diff --git a/jcfa/testJavaClass/output/test/TestJavaClass003.jcfa b/jcfa/testJavaClass/output/test/TestJavaClass003.jcfa index 66635b2..38a919a 100644 --- a/jcfa/testJavaClass/output/test/TestJavaClass003.jcfa +++ b/jcfa/testJavaClass/output/test/TestJavaClass003.jcfa @@ -1,20 +1,20 @@ package test; -/* TODO import func. is missing. */ +/** TODO import func. is missing. */ public class TestJavaClass003 { - /* */ + /** */ private int test001; - /* */ + /** */ private int test002; - /* */ + /** */ private int test003; - /* */ + /** */ private int test004; - /* */ + /** */ private int test005; - /* */ + /** */ private int test006; - /* */ + /** */ private int test007; /** Default constructor. */ -- 2.11.0